Last Matches & H2H

Brighton won 5-0 against Sheffield United in their previous match, registering ten shots on target. They had 80% possession at Bramall Lane, Facundo Buonanotte, Danny Welbeck and Simon Adingra (2) scoring goals in this Premier League match.

Everton drew 1-1 in their previous match against Crystal Palace. They managed to have 63% possession in this game, with Amadou Onana on the scoresheet in this Premier League match at Goodison Park.

Brighton and Everton played out a 1-1 draw at Goodison Park when they last met.

The last 9 games between Brighton and Everton have featured an average of 3.56 goals being scored. Brighton have won three, two draws and Everton have won four.
